不知道各位有没有遇到过这样的情况?
比如我搜索“关键词A”,搜索结果显示的网址是网站首页,但标题并不是网站本身的title,而是包含“关键词A”的一个小长尾,搜索“关键词B”,同样也是这样的情况,而我从来没修改过标题。
“关键词A”,我从前做过这个词的锚文本指向首页;
“关键词B”,在首页重要位置用了h2标签,
这些可以解释出现上述现象的原因么?
我的理解是程序代码有问题。
具体情况要看了网站才能详细说明.
这个问题应该可以这样理解 第一种是百度觉得你的某个文章页面 当然那篇文章页面的标题包括关键词A的一个小长尾 更符合用户体验,因此在调整排名时便把权重高即你的首页面展示给用户 第二种可能是百度更新调整所出现的BUG 这种BUG在千篇万绿的网络世界里是无奇不有的 只要排名正常就不要管了。
###有时候百度在爬取的过程中会出现这样的问题,有的网站出现的可能是其他的东西,如导航或是网站底部的内容。
标题描述设置的不合理:如果你的标题或者描述,这里主要指的是描述,出现关键词堆砌或者搜索引擎认为不合理的话,可能会出现不显示或者搜索引擎自己提取网站内容作为描述来显示。
**
百度的数据抓取能力**
尤其是使用CDN的网站,一般来说百度爬虫缓存域名对应服务器IP的时间是超过1天,蜘蛛爬网站的时候,没有按照DNS协议去缓存dns记录,而是缓存dns记录1天以上,所以当CDN换了IP,百度蜘蛛在一天内会还一直爬不能访问的旧服务器IP。这样就会造成某个节点的数据不能被抓取的现象,从而出现网站标题和描述不能正常显示。
robots.txt文件
一般来说,出现这种情况就是当Robots.txt中设置某一个特定URL为“Nofollow、noindex”,虽然这个指令告诉搜索引擎不要跟踪,以及收录这条链接。但是如果有一定数量的外链指向这条链接,搜索引擎也许会收录该URL。而此时的标题则有可能为URL,描述则为空。
本文来自投稿,不代表微盟圈立场,如若转载,请注明出处:https://www.vm7.com/a/ask/17447.html